Tex's Pork Steak in Onion Gravy
- 1 pork loin steak
- 1 large onion
- 2 tbsp groundnut or rapeseed oil
- 1 tbsp unsalted butter
- 1 tsp soft brown sugar
- 1/4 cup red wine vinegar
- 3/4 liter hot water
- 1 beef Oxo cube
- 2 tbsp beef gravy granules
- 1 tbsp tomato ketchup
- Heat a skillet to a high temperature until smoking.
- Brush the pork with the oil.
- Use an oil with a high smoke point, not olive oil or butter.
- Fry in the pan for 1 1/2 minutes each side, then remove and set aside to rest.
- If your meat starts to curl, place a saucepan half-filled with water to hold it flat, ensuring even cooking.
- Remove the pork from the pan and allow to rest.
- Turn the heat down to low, add the oil and butter.
- Slice the onion quite thickly.
- Cook low and slow for 5 minutes then add the sugar and half of the vinegar to encourage caramelisation.
- Cook for a further 5 minutes
- While the onion is cooking prep the gravy.
- In a jug, stir all the ingredients into the hot water and allow to sit until the onions are done.
- Deglaze the pan by adding the rest of the vinegar and scraping the bottom with a metal spatula.
- Put the meat back into the pan, increase the heat to medium low, then stir in 3/4 of the gravy.
- Bring to a nice simmer stirring all the time, then cook for a further 10 minutes turning the steak once until nicely reduced.
- If your gravy starts to thicken too much add some more from the jug.
- When it's just the right consistency cover the pan and remove from the heat.
- If your pan doesn't have a lid, use a lid from another pan or aluminium foil.
- Set to one side while you prep your veg.
- I'm serving mine with homemade baked beans, with butter and rosemary glazed baked potatoes, so I allow the meat and gravy to cool until the veg is about 5 minutes away from being done, then I put it back on a low heat, still covered, and reheat, stirring frequently.
- When your veg is ready, add to the plate, followed by your pork , then drizzle with the gravy
- Season, serve, and enjoy
